NAME

       dhcpcd-qt — a Qt frontend for network configuration

DESCRIPTION

       dhcpcd-qt  is  a  Qt  frontend  for  network  configuration.   It uses dhcpcd(8) and wpa_supplicant(8) as
       backends.

       If dhcpcd-qt is used to make configuration changes then the user  needs  to  be  able  to  write  to  the
       privileged dhcpcd control socket.  See dhcpcd.conf(5) for details.

   wpa_supplicant
       dhcpcd-qt  relies  on wpa_supplicant(8) being configured to write its sockets to /var/run/wpa_supplicant.
       If dhcpcd-qt is used to select and set pass phrases for wireless networks then update_config=1  needs  to
       be set in wpa_supplicant.conf.
